I don't have crazy,
controlling, cravings, for many places. But this is definitely a place I get the cravies for.
Their meat is savory and delicious. And I can get french fries in my gyro just the way I like it. Spitz is one of a few casual restaurants I can get lamb. They have a large, varied, craft-heavy beer selection.
But most importantly, the staff is always amazing! They are always friendly, helpful, kind, and full of great energy and grace every time I've gone. I don't know if all their restaurants hire such exceptional people but the Los Felix location sure does.
The atmosphere is vibrant, contemporary, funky, punky, and street inspired with murals of paper tile mosaics of Xerox imagery.
And the lighting is boss. It's clever and arty but practical and inspires in that DIY way.
